Typical tutoring rates in Harlow


Based on regional data in 2026, the average cost for a private tutor in Harlow is approximately £28.00/hour. Rates typically range from:



  • £20–£30/hour: university students and newly qualified tutors.

  • £30–£45/hour: experienced tutors and subject specialists.

  • £45–£60+/hour: highly experienced teachers and Oxbridge prep.


Many tutors offer free initial consultations and discounts for block bookings.

Students of all ages attend our study centre on a Thursday. In these sessions they will hand in their completed work and begin their new set of work with the support of our tutors; their work will be returned and discussed with their tutor. They are then set a programme of work of 10-15 minutes per day to do at home, practising what they have learnt in the class to ensure proficiency and fluency at each step. Through our structured programmes, our team individualises each child’s learning path, which is targeted to fill any existing gaps in their understanding. This helps with their schoolwork, builds confidence, and develops independent learning skills, all of which are extremely important in today's busy classrooms in schools. Our English and maths programmes are flexible and tailored to learners' individual needs and abilities, so students move on only when they are confident with a topic. Regular testing ensures that the best possible progress is made. The 'little and often' approach, with plenty of repetition and practice, really does make a huge difference. How we work? The first step is to arrange for your child to complete our online maths and English Skills Assessment. The Assessment is national curriculum aligned and will highlight the strengths and weaknesses your child may be experiencing at school. Using this information, we will draft an individual learning plan listing the areas we will cover and the learning tools we will use. We will also send you a report listing how your child has performed against the national curriculum. After this, your child will be invited to one of our classes for a two-week free trial. Although, the first few weeks can be difficult as we try to implement a new after school routine, it should give you enough time to understand our learning model. When your child attends each class, they will sit in their own space and a tutor will approach them. Based on the individual learning plan, the tutor will take the first area we need to cover and teach your child on a one-to-one basis. The tutor will then watch your child answer a few questions to ensure they have understood the tools we have taught. To cement the learning, your child will receive some practice questions to do in class and at home. For homework, we ask they do a little bit each day; the objective is to ensure they remember what we have covered and cement it in their mind. All of your child’s work is marked and returned with detailed feedback. We will continue the same cycle, increasing the difficulty and moving on to the next module as listed in the individual learning plan. All our materials are national curriculum aligned so we will be working towards the same objectives as the schools. Also, our materials are managed by a team of teachers and exam invigilators, so it is always up to date. What do you love most about your job?

I have been working with children and young people since 1999 so I have had the opportunity to see children grow into successful adults. Amongst many, there are two things I absolutely love about this job:
- Former students coming back to us to say thank you and tell us how much our team have helped them succeed, and,
- Witnessing a child's excitement when they unlock a new skill.

What inspired you to start your own business?

I used to volunteer at a local community centre with inspirational kids as they were full of energy and had an opinion about everything. However, I was shocked to find out that those craving more education had limited options as private schools were expensive. Also, there were kids that were great at many things but lack understanding of a particular subject or was not inspired by their teachers and needed a fresh approach to the subject.

I realised these children needed a service that could offer a different approach to learning. It needed to be new, hands-on and focused on the particular area of need.
